Home Window Installation in Portland, ME
Home window installation services involve replacing or adding wind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These projects can include installing new windows during a home renovation, replacing outdated or damaged windows, or upgrading to more energy-efficient models.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of windows available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, as well as the benefits of various materials and styles to ensure the new installation complements the home's design and meets their needs.
Before requesting window installation services, homeowners should consider factors like the size and placement of windows, the materials that suit their climate and aesthetic preferences,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It's also helpful to have an understanding of the existing window frames and the condition of surrounding structures to determine if additional repairs are necessary. Clear communication about project goals and expectations can help ensure the installation process proceeds smoothly and results in a functional, attractive upgrade.

Common Home Window Installation Jobs
Double-pane window installation - improves energy efficiency and reduces noise inside the home.
Picture window installation - enhances natural light and offers expansive outdoor views.
Bay and bow window installation - adds architectural interest and increases interior space.
Vinyl window replacement - provides low-maintenance, durable options for homeowners.
Custom window installation - fits unique openings and matches specific design preferences.
Energy-efficient window upgrades - help lower utility bills and improve overall comfort.
Home Window Installation Questions
What types of windows are available for installation? A variety of window styles can be installed, including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, to suit different needs and preferences.
Is new window installation suitable for all property types? Yes, window installation services can be customized for residential homes, multi-family buildings, and commercial properties.
What should homeowners consider before choosing new windows? Factors such as energy efficiency, durability, style, and compatibility with existing structures are important to consider.
Can existing windows be replaced without major renovations? In many cases, window replacements can be completed with minimal disruption, often fitting into existing openings without extensive modifications.
